Perth Glory back top of A-League table with Adelaide United draw

Perth Glory returned to the top of the A-League standings despite only drawing 1-1 with Adelaide United on Sunday.

Hosts Adelaide took the lead in the 11th minute through striker Pablo Sanchez, but Perth were on level terms in the 56th minute when midfielder Nebojsa Marinkovic found the back of the net.

The draw enabled Perth to move a point above Melbourne Victory into first place, with 34 points gleaned from their 17 matches.

On Saturday, Melbourne Victory played out a dramatic 3-3 draw away at Sydney FC.
